What is Compute Engine?

Google Compute Engine (GCE) is an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) offering that provides virtual machines (VMs) in Google's data centers. It allows users to run workloads on demand, scaling resources up or down as needed. It is commonly used for hosting web applications, running batch processing jobs, and building scalable infrastructure.
